> i m always getting new session id on each request, i m using apache cxf 2.7.5
> version, i have also tried various solutions like,
> Map<String, Object> properties = new HashMap<String, Object>();
> properties.put("thread.local.request.context", Boolean.TRUE);
>
> properties.put("org.apache.cxf.message.Message.MAINTAIN_SESSION",Boolean.TRUE);
>
> factory = new JaxWsProxyFactoryBean();
> factory.getInInterceptors().add(new LoggingInInterceptor());
> factory.getOutInterceptors().add(new LoggingOutInterceptor());
> factory.setServiceClass(MarsWebService.class);
> factory.setAddress("http://localhost:8080/HelloWorld/ws/HWebService?wsdl");
> but no luck, i have also bind an user with session id and set web service
> client at session level like
> HTTP Session Listner
> if(webServiceClient.get(httpSession.getId()) == null){
> Client client = new Client();
> httpSession.setAttribute(httpSession.getId(), client);
> }
> Struts1 action
> HttpSession httpSession = request.getSession();
> Client client = (Client) httpSession.getAttribute(httpSession.getId());
